
"When Mary Lanaghan's husband left her in 1985, she took her four children to the country - or so it seemed then - and found a house by a lake in the woods. She was unable to afford as much land about her as she would have liked, but for some years she and her two girls and two boys lived with the sounds of birds and at night only starlight. It was a refuge from the suburb where her neighbors had watched her marriage come apart.". "Now, as Mary Lanaghan approaches fifty years of age, her children have grown and moved away, and she must create a new life for herself. She finds solace in the beauty of the earth around her - the sky shifting with each season, the lake reflecting the movement and color above it, the woods that envelop her during long walks with her dog. But her new friend, Ron Starks, a gay man who, with his lover, owns the local diner, is nudging Mary into the world of dating, a messy world in which her own children are floundering about. A Circle Around Her is Jonathon Strong's humorous and touching new novel about the fateful season that brings Mary together with an extended family of children, friends, and lovers, while she rediscovers a spirit of independence and begins to cultivate a strength within."--BOOK JACKET.
